Transitive Verbbadger
[~ someone for something][~ someone to do something]

To repeatedly pester, harass, or annoy someone with persistent requests or questions.

The children continued to badger their father for a new toy.

Phrasal Verbs

badger into

to persist in pestering someone until they agree to do something

The kids badgered their mother into taking them to the zoo.
